“Abraham Lincoln: Vampire Hunter – A Bloodthirsty Twist on History’s Greatest Leader”
“Abraham Lincoln: Vampire Hunter,” directed by Timur Bekmambetov, is a thrilling and audacious blend of historical drama and supernatural horror that reimagines the life of one of America’s most revered leaders. Released in 2012, this film takes viewers on a dark and action-packed journey through an alternate history where Abraham Lincoln’s legacy is intertwined with a secret war against vampires.
Plot Summary:
Set against the backdrop of the American Civil War, the film follows the iconic Abraham Lincoln (Benjamin Walker) as he evolves from a young, grief-stricken boy into a vampire hunter determined to eradicate the undead scourge responsible for his mother’s death. Guided by his mentor, Henry Sturges (Dominic Cooper), Lincoln embarks on a perilous mission to rid the nation of vampires who are manipulating the conflict for their own gain. As the 16th President of the United States, Lincoln wages a dual battle—one against the Confederate Army and another against the vampire menace, culminating in a climactic showdown.

Notable Performances:
Benjamin Walker delivers a compelling performance as Abraham Lincoln, portraying the character’s transformation from a grief-stricken young man to a formidable vampire hunter with depth and conviction. Dominic Cooper’s portrayal of Henry Sturges adds a layer of mystery and mentorship to the narrative. Rufus Sewell’s depiction of the malevolent vampire leader, Adam, adds a sinister presence to the film.

Critical Acclaim:
“Abraham Lincoln: Vampire Hunter” received mixed reviews from critics, with some praising its unique concept and action sequences, while others found fault with the film’s departure from historical accuracy. However, it garnered a dedicated fanbase drawn to its imaginative reinterpretation of history.
